Noel William Hinners, born on December 25, 1935, was a distinguished figure in the field of space exploration and geology. His career spanned several decades, during which he made significant contributions to NASA's space programs and later at Lockheed Martin. Hinners grew up in Chatham, New Jersey, as one of eight siblings. His father worked as an insurance agent, while his mother was a homemaker. His academic journey began at Rutgers University, where he obtained a Bachelor of Agricultural Science in 1958. |
